同义词辨析

inventcreatedevise【导航词义:发明】

inventv. 发明,创造
〔辨析〕
指通过研究、思考等制造出前所未有之物,多用于科技领域。
〔例证〕
Who invented the printer?
谁发明了打印机?
He didn't know when the telephone was invented.
他不知道电话是什么时候发明的。
createv. 创造,创建
〔辨析〕
指创造出以前并不存在的新事物。
〔例证〕
The government planned to create more than 200 new jobs.
政府计划创造二百多个新的就业机会。
He created a new kind of game.
他发明了一种新游戏。
devisev. 设计,发明
〔辨析〕
指想出做某事的新方法。
〔例证〕
He devised a method to ease the traffic jams in the city.
他发明出一种缓解该市交通拥堵的方法。

牛津词典

    verb

    • 创造;创作;创建
      to make sth happen or exist
      1. Scientists disagree about how the universe was created.
        科学家对宇宙是怎样形成的有分歧。
      2. The main purpose of industry is to create wealth.
        工业的主要宗旨是创造财富。
      3. The government plans to create more jobs for young people.
        政府计划为年轻人创造更多的就业机会。
      4. Create a new directory and put all your files into it.
        创建一个新的目录,然后把你所有的文件都放进去。
      5. Try this new dish, created by our head chef.
        品尝一下这道新菜吧,是我们厨师长首创的。
    • 造成,引起,产生(感觉或印象)
      to produce a particular feeling or impression
      1. The company is trying to create a young energetic image.
        这家公司正试图塑造一个充满活力的年轻形象。
      2. The announcement only succeeded in creating confusion.
        那通告反而引起了混乱。
      3. They've painted it red to create a feeling of warmth.
        他们把它刷成红色以造成一种温暖的感觉。
    • 授予;册封
      to give sb a particular rank or title
      1. The government has created eight new peers.
        政府新封了八个贵族。
      2. He was created a baronet in 1715.
        他于1715年被封为准男爵。

    柯林斯词典

    • VERB 创造;使发生;创建
      Tocreatesomething means to cause it to happen or exist.
      1. We set business free to create more jobs in Britain...
        我们放开对企业的限制以便在英国创造更多的就业机会。
      2. She could create a fight out of anything...
        她能无故挑起事端。
      3. The lights create such a glare it's next to impossible to see anything behind them...
        那些灯发出的光太强了,几乎看不清灯后面的任何东西。
      4. Criticizing will only destroy a relationship and create feelings of failure.
        批评责备只能破坏关系,让人产生失败感。
    • VERB 创造;发明;设计
      When someonecreatesa new product or process, they invent it or design it.
      1. It is really great for a radio producer to create a show like this...
        电台监制能够制作出这样的节目真是不简单。
      2. He's creating a whole new language of painting.
        他正在创造一种全新的绘画语言。
